Mozart’s London Sketchbook contains short pieces that the child prodigy wrote while on tour in London, and his Andante in Eb major is a great starting point for learning about ternary form. The piece has a clear ABAstructure, with each section being 8 bars long. As is customary, each section is repeated. WebThe TERNARY FORM is a three-part piece of continuous music in an ABA (or ABA’) structure where the outer two sections are identical or practically identical and the interior section is fundamentally different.
